Finished Basement HVAC Options

Finished basements in Indianapolis fight cool floors, summer humidity, and sometimes groundwater or vapor sources that no thermostat can outrun. Options include extending central ducts when returns allow, adding a ductless mini-split for an independent setpoint, and pairing either path with a dedicated dehumidifier for latent load. Encapsulation, drainage, and filtration decisions belong in the same conversation as tonnage. The winning plan for Central Indiana treats moisture and air paths first, then chooses capacity so the finished space stays dry enough for real living — not just a cool-but-clammy game room.

How it works

Capacity path: duct extend, ductless, or hybrid

A duct extend adds supply and return to the finished zone when the air handler has spare CFM. A mini-split gives independent control. Hybrids use a light duct extend plus a dehumidifier or a small ductless head for stubborn corners.

Moisture path: dehumidifier, drainage, and vapor control

Central Indiana basements carry latent load that AC alone may not remove at low thermostat runtimes. A whole-home or basement dehumidifier, working drains, and honest vapor strategies keep finishes and air quality intact. Commission temperature and relative humidity together on a humid week — cool-but-clammy still fails Central Indiana basement comfort.

Return air and filtration strategy

Pulling return from a damp unfinished alcove can load the coil with moisture and dust. Put returns in the conditioned finished volume, size them correctly, and match filter cabinets to the blower’s static budget. Commission for both temperature and RH

After install, verify basement temperature and relative humidity on a humid week — not only whether the thermostat clicks off. Sticky air at 72°F is still a failed basement comfort plan. What goes wrong when this is ignored

Ignoring vapor and drainage

Equipment cannot outrun a wet basement forever. Musty odors, cupped floors, and high RH return when sump, grading, or vapor issues stay unsolved. Solve water and vapor sources alongside equipment or the musty pattern returns every sticky summer. Confirm details on site for your address and equipment.

Extending supplies without adequate returns

Dumping cold air into a finished basement with no return path creates pressure problems, drain-downs upstairs, and uneven comfort. Returns are not optional trim. Oversizing the main system “for the basement”

A larger single-stage plant short-cycles the whole house and still leaves the basement clammy. Zone the problem or add dehumidification instead of cloning bigger tonnage. Solve water and vapor sources alongside equipment or the musty pattern returns every sticky summer.

Frequently asked questions

Is a mini-split or a duct extension better for a finished Indianapolis basement?+

Do I still need a dehumidifier if I install a basement mini-split?+

Can I finish the basement first and add HVAC later?+

You can, but you will pay for it in open walls, chase planning, and condensate routes. Rough-in returns, line-set paths, and drain lines before insulation and drywall when possible.

Why does my basement feel cold even when the upstairs is comfortable?+

Slab and earth temperatures pull heat, and supply air may bypass the occupied zone. Balancing, returns, and sometimes a dedicated zone fix the feel better than cranking the whole-house thermostat.

Will basement HVAC affect radon or indoor air quality?+

Air-sealing, filtration, and pressure balance matter. Do not create large negative pressure that pulls soil gases. Coordinate with any radon system and keep returns in conditioned space. Filtration and IAQ guidance live under /healthy-home and IAQ Learn pages.
